Understanding Peer-to-Peer Transactions
Peer-to-peer (P2P) transactions represent direct transfers of value between individuals without intermediaries. As defined by the Financial Action Task Force, these are virtual asset transfers conducted without involvement of a VASP or other obliged entity. This pure model of exchange traces back to the very first Bitcoin transfer in 2009, when Satoshi Nakamoto sent coins directly from one wallet to another, birthing the vision of a purely peer-to-peer version of electronic cash.
At its core, P2P removes institutional gatekeepers, allowing each participant to act on their own behalf. Users connect wallets, sign transactions cryptographically, and broadcast transfers to a decentralized network, where consensus protocols ensure integrity and finality without centralized oversight.
The Foundational Principles of Decentralization
Decentralization lies at the heart of P2P networks. Unlike traditional systems that rely on central servers, every node in a P2P network functions as both client and server. This architecture fosters resilience and censorship resistance, since no single point of failure can disrupt the entire system.
Each node maintains a complete copy of the ledger, enabling continuous verification through digital signatures and proof-of-work consensus. This process secures the network against tampering, solving the double-spending problem without requiring trust in third parties.
How Peer-to-Peer Networks Operate
Understanding the transaction flow is vital for both beginners and seasoned users. A typical P2P transaction proceeds as follows:
- A sender creates and digitally signs a transaction in their wallet.
- The transaction is broadcast to all connected nodes on the network.
- Nodes collect pending transactions into a candidate block and perform proof-of-work.
- Upon finding a valid proof-of-work, the new block is propagated globally.
- All honest nodes verify and accept the block, updating their ledgers accordingly.
This distributed mechanism offers intrinsic security, ensuring that transactions become irreversible once embedded in the blockchain’s history.

Challenges and Risk Mitigation
No system is without challenges. P2P transactions introduce unique risks that users must navigate proactively:
- Trust requirements: Counterparty trust is crucial; use reputable platforms for escrow.
- Regulatory blind spots: Lack of Travel Rule data or KYC can attract scrutiny.
- Security vulnerabilities: Phishing and private key theft remain primary threats.
To mitigate these risks, follow practical best practices:
1. Choose wallets with built-in two-factor authentication and encryption.
2. Verify counterparties through decentralized reputation systems or escrow services.
3. Employ hardware wallets for large holdings, keeping private keys offline.
4. Leverage blockchain analytics tools to monitor suspicious wallet clusters and ensure compliance readiness.
Navigating the Regulatory Landscape
Regulators worldwide are grappling with how to oversee P2P transactions without stifling innovation. While frameworks like MiCA target centralized entities, P2P exchanges often exist in a gray area, balancing digital asset freedom with legal obligations.
Compliance teams can adopt specialized solutions:
- Deploy blockchain analytics for sanctions screening and transaction pattern analysis.
- Engage with self-regulatory organizations to establish industry standards.
- Stay informed about evolving Travel Rule exceptions and KYC requirements.
